In the realm of medical practice, encountering and managing rare diseases can be a challenging task. These conditions, due to their low prevalence, often present diagnostic hurdles and treatment dilemmas for clinicians. This guide aims to provide a comprehensive approach towards identifying and managing such rare but critical medical conditions.
Early identification of rare diseases is crucial to prevent severe complications and improve patient outcomes. However, the rarity and diversity of these conditions often lead to misdiagnosis. Clinicians should maintain a high index of suspicion, especially when dealing with atypical presentations. Comprehensive medical and family histories, combined with thorough physical examinations, are essential. Genetic testing can also be a valuable tool in the diagnosis of certain rare diseases.
Due to the limited number of cases, evidence-based guidelines for managing rare diseases are often lacking. However, a multidisciplinary approach involving specialists, genetic counselors, and allied health professionals can help tailor the management plan to the patient's needs. Clinicians should also consider referring patients to specialized centers or enrolling them in clinical trials, where available.
Continuing medical education plays a pivotal role in staying abreast with the latest developments in the field of rare diseases. Clinicians should actively participate in seminars, workshops, and online courses focusing on rare diseases. Additionally, networking with experts in the field can provide valuable insights and guidance.
While rare diseases pose significant challenges, a systematic approach to their identification and management can significantly improve patient outcomes. Clinicians should maintain an open mind, embrace lifelong learning, and make use of all available resources to tackle these medical enigmas.
